Expert Verdict

Palm-derived — RSPO certification and sustainability documentation essential for COSMOS/ECOCERT and market positioning; potentially drying at high concentrations without co-surfactant blending; virtually identical safety profile to sodium palmate with additional hydrogenation saturation
